LEWIS v. STATE

No. 35782.

367 S.W.2d 692 (1963)

Ira LEWIS, Appellant, v. The STATE of Texas, Appellee.

Court of Criminal Appeals of Texas.

May 15, 1963.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Plummer & Wade, Houston, for appellant.

Frank Briscoe, Dist. Atty., Houston, Daniel P. Ryan, Jr., and Gene D. Miles, Asst. Dist. Attys., Houston, and Leon B. Douglas, State's Atty., Austin, for the State.


DICE, Commissioner.

The conviction is for aggravated assault; the punishment, one month in jail.
